Tony Simion is a Managing Director with Alvarez & Marsal Restructuring & Turnaround in Detroit. He specializes in operational and financial restructuring, turnaround consulting, and interim management.

With over 20 years of experience, Mr. Simion brings expertise in: in- and out-of-court restructurings; business plan development and assessments; customer, vendor, and labor negotiations; liquidity and treasury management; and various profit improvement initiatives. He has worked with clients across various industries, including automotive, commodities, home building, real estate, stored energy devices, internet and SaaS, commercial landscaping, and residential mortgage servicing.

Notably, Mr. Simion completed a prepacked Chapter 11 of Dynata. The 54-day case resulted in a reduction of around 40% of its total debt from approximately $1.3 billion to $780 million. Prior to this, Mr. Simion completed an out-of-court restructuring of a premium aftermarket automotive supplier. Within three months, the company refinanced its credit facility and secured an un-drawn ABL for additional liquidity purposes. Mr. Simion’s other notable assignments include providing turnaround and restructuring advisory services to Babcock & Wilcox, Washington Prime Group, Sable Permian Resources, Paddock Enterprises, LLC, GST AutoLeather, Noranda Aluminum, Exide Technologies, and A123 Systems.

Previously, Mr. Simion was the Chief Restructuring Officer for a privately held Tier 1 heavy truck supplier in the heavy tonnage injection molding industry. Within six months, he negotiated a forbearance with the company’s secured lender, accommodations with customers providing price increases and liquidity support, and the divesting of an underperforming division.

Prior to joining A&M, Mr. Simion was the North America Controller for the Engine Cooling division of Behr America Industries and a Plant Controller at Guardian Industries. Previously, he held multiple roles in operations and finance for the Nonwovens division of Kimberly-Clark Corporation.

Mr. Simion earned a bachelor’s degree in chemical engineering from Michigan Technological University and an MBA (concentration in finance) from the Babcock School of Management at Wake Forest University. He is a Certified Insolvency and Restructuring Advisor and a member of the Association of Insolvency and Restructuring Advisors, the Turnaround Management Association, and the American Bankruptcy Institute.
